Cover blurb: A WONDERFUL COLLECTION OF SELF-DEPRECATING BUT INSPIRING ANECDOTES. Not just an autobiography, ’My Dalek Has A Puncture’ is the first of a Trilogy following the hectic, hysterical and honest path taken by actor Simon Fisher-Becker, best known to Sci-Fi fans Worldwide as the bald, blue intergalactic back-marketeer Dorium Maldovar from the BBC’s hugely successful series Doctor Who. Ideal for all aspiring performers particularly drama students and arts graduates, victims of bullying and those who feel frustrated and unhappy with their lot. This natural raconteur offers incite [sic] and advice well beyond that of ‘Pick yourself up, brush yourself down and start all over again.’ |
